What kind of jobs can I expect after BSc food science and management and an MBA in human resources? Is the combination good?

Natasha, HR has a broad variety of profiles within any company. Talent Acquisition, Payroll and Compensation, Complaince, Onboarding, are few roles for which MBA in Human Resources Candidates are hired. So your B.Sc needn't mandatorily compliment your MBA. But because experience gives you opportunities, you can also move up the ladder in Health Care and Food Technology companies in various roles. For a starter, if you complete your MBA in HR, you can try as a HR Analyst, Staffing Specialist, Technical Recruiter, Learning and Department Analyst, Employee Relations Analyst, etc. As you pile up experience, you will move slowly to the roles of Team Leader, Assistant Manager, Manager, Operations Manager, AVP, VP, etc.
